Researchers discovered 725 Ruby libraries on the official RubyGems repository contained malware intended to copy users' clipboards, targeting bitcoin payments — Typosquatting barrage on RubyGems software repository users — Tomislav Maljic, Threat Analyst at ReversingLabs. ,| Maggie Miller / The Hill: |
FBI says it is receiving ~3,000-4,000 cybersecurity complaints per day during the pandemic, up from ~1,000 complaints it was receiving daily before the outbreak — The FBI has seen a spike in cyber crimes reported to its Internet Crime Complaint Center (IC3) since the beginning of the COVID-19 pandemic … | Catalin Cimpanu / ZDNet: |
Group-IB: the average price of phishing kits rose 149% YoY to $304 in 2019 and the number of kit sellers grew 120% — The average price for a phishing kit in 2019 was $304, up from $122 recorded in 2018. — The average price of a phishing kit sold on cybercrime markets has gone up in 2019 by 149% … | Arielle Pardes / Wired: |
